THE RELATIONSHIP OF CULTURE AND HEALTH The experiences that people have throughout their lives and the material and spiritual values that they create together with the society are called culture. They are our traditions and customs that are passed down from generation to generation. Culture consists of the environment in which it is formed, the geographical features of the region, its belief, history and its sub-titles. No matter how much the development and knowledge level of the society advances, its cultural values vary according to the region, the family or region where it grew up. The cultural values that people have learned since their existence also affect their perception of their own health.
